Rumah > pembangunan bahagian belakang > tutorial php > Bagaimana untuk menyambung ke pangkalan data Redis menggunakan PDO

Bagaimana untuk menyambung ke pangkalan data Redis menggunakan PDO

PHPz
Lepaskan: 2023-07-28 17:32:02
asal
1361 orang telah melayarinya

Cara menggunakan PDO untuk menyambung ke pangkalan data Redis

Redis ialah sumber terbuka, berprestasi tinggi, pangkalan data nilai kunci storan dalam memori, yang biasa digunakan dalam cache, baris gilir dan senario lain. Dalam pembangunan PHP, menggunakan Redis boleh meningkatkan prestasi dan kestabilan aplikasi dengan berkesan. Melalui sambungan PDO (Objek Data PHP), kami boleh menyambung dan mengendalikan pangkalan data Redis dengan lebih mudah. Artikel ini akan menerangkan cara menggunakan PDO untuk menyambung ke pangkalan data Redis, dengan contoh kod.

  1. Pasang sambungan Redis
    Sebelum anda bermula, anda perlu memastikan anda telah memasang sambungan Redis. Anda boleh mendayakan sambungan Redis dalam fail konfigurasi php.ini, atau pasang sambungan Redis melalui arahan berikut:

    pecl install redis
    Salin selepas log masuk
  2. Buat objek sambungan PDO
    Pertama, anda perlu mencipta objek sambungan PDO untuk mewujudkan sambungan dengan Redis. Gunakan kod berikut untuk mencipta objek sambungan:

    $redis_dsn = 'redis:host=127.0.0.1;port=6379';
    $redis_username = '';
    $redis_password = '';
    try {
     $pdo = new PDO($redis_dsn, $redis_username, $redis_password);
    } catch (PDOException $e) {
     die('数据库连接失败:' . $e->getMessage());
    }
    Salin selepas log masuk

    Dalam kod di atas, $redis_dsn ialah DSN (nama sumber data) sambungan pangkalan data Redis, yang menentukan alamat IP dan nombor port pelayan Redis. Jika pengesahan kata laluan diperlukan, anda boleh menambah parameter kata laluan dalam $redis_dsn.

  3. Laksanakan arahan Redis
    Selepas sambungan berjaya, anda boleh menggunakan objek PDO untuk melaksanakan arahan Redis. Berikut ialah beberapa contoh perintah Redis yang biasa digunakan:

A Tetapkan pasangan nilai kunci

$pdo->exec("SET mykey 'Hello Redis'");
Salin selepas log masuk

B Dapatkan pasangan nilai kunci

$stmt = $pdo->query("GET mykey");
$value = $stmt->fetchColumn();
echo $value; // 输出 Hello Redis
Salin selepas log masuk

C Padam pasangan nilai kunci

$pdo->exec("DEL mykey");
Salin selepas log masuk

D . menyambung ke pangkalan data Redis adalah sangat mudah, cuma Anda perlu mencipta objek sambungan melalui pembina PDO, dan kemudian gunakan objek PDO untuk melaksanakan arahan Redis. Dengan menyambung kepada Redis melalui PDO, anda boleh mengendalikan pangkalan data Redis dengan mudah dan memberikan permainan sepenuhnya kepada kelebihan Redis dalam caching, beratur dan senario lain.

Nota: Dalam pembangunan sebenar, adalah disyorkan untuk menggunakan sambungan khusus Redis (seperti sambungan phpredis) untuk menyambung dan mengendalikan Redis, kerana sambungan ini telah lebih dioptimumkan dan diuji serta mempunyai prestasi yang lebih baik. Artikel ini memperkenalkan kaedah menggunakan PDO untuk menyambung ke Redis, yang sesuai untuk situasi di mana PDO perlu digunakan untuk mengendalikan berbilang pangkalan data secara seragam.

Atas ialah kandungan terperinci Bagaimana untuk menyambung ke pangkalan data Redis menggunakan PDO.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Label berkaitan:
s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an